Bill Summary

Authorizing The Town Of Barrington To Finance The Construction, Improvement, Renovation, Alteration, Furnishing And ?equipping Of Public Schools And School Facilities In The Town And All Expenses Incident Thereto Including, But Not Limited To, Costs Of Design, Athletic Fields, Playgrounds, Landscaping, Parking And Costs Of Financing And To Issue Not More Than $250,000,000 Bonds And/or Notes Therefor, Subject To Approval Of State Housing Aid At A Reimbursement Rate Or State Share Ratio Of Not Less Than 35 Percent At The Time Of Issuance And Provided That The Authorization Shall Be Reduced By The Amount Of Certain Grants Received From State Bond Proceeds, From The Rhode Island Department Of Education Or From The Rhode Island School Building Authority

AI Summary

This bill authorizes the Town of Barrington to issue up to $250,000,000 in bonds and/or notes to finance the construction, improvement, renovation, alteration, furnishing, and equipping of public schools and school facilities in the town. The bonds would be subject to approval of state housing aid at a reimbursement rate or state share ratio of at least 35% at the time of issuance, and the authorization would be reduced by the amount of certain grants received from state bond proceeds, the Rhode Island Department of Education, or the Rhode Island School Building Authority. The bill requires the town council to adopt a resolution specifying the exact principal amount of bonds and notes to be presented to the voters, and potentially the specific schools and facilities to be financed. The bill also requires voter approval at the November 2023 general election before the bonds can be issued.
